Abstract

An intelligent teaching device system for ideological and political education comprises a control platform, a projector, a writing display mechanism and an erasing mechanism; the writing display mechanism comprises an installation cover, a lifting frame, a rack and a writing display component, and the writing display component comprises a writing display board, a rotating shaft and a gear; the erasing mechanism comprises a pushing table, a roller, a connecting column, a moving frame and a vibration erasing component for erasing chalk marks on the writing surface of the writing display panel, and the pushing table is provided with an arc-shaped guide surface which is used for preventing the vibration erasing component from interfering the rotation of the writing display panel when the writing display panel rotates and enabling the vibration erasing component to be in contact with the writing display panel after the writing display panel rotates completely. The invention can write on the writing display board, can remove chalk marks after the writing display board is turned over, saves time and labor, and can project a wider range of pictures on the writing display board through the projector.

As shown in fig. 1 to 10, the intelligent teaching device system for ideological and political education according to the present invention includes a control platform 100, a projector 200, a writing display mechanism 300 and an erasing mechanism 400;
the writing display mechanism 300 comprises a mounting cover 1 and a lifting frame 15, rack 16 and writing display module, writing display module is provided with the multiunit side by side along vertical direction, writing display module includes writing display panel 2, axis of rotation 8 and gear 9, be provided with on the installation cover 1 and be used for supplying to write display panel 2 pivoted rotating channel 101, be provided with on the installation cover 1 and be used for driving crane 15 to remove so that writing display panel 2 rotates 180 drive assembly along vertical direction, rack 16 is vertical to be set up on crane 15, writing display panel 2 thickness direction both sides surface sets up respectively to be used for accepting the display surface that projecting apparatus 200 throws the picture and the writing surface that is used for the chalk to write, axis of rotation 8 sets up in writing display panel 2 along horizontal side middle part, axis of rotation 8 rotates and sets up on installation cover 1, gear 9 sets up on axis of rotation 8, gear 9 is connected with rack 16 meshing;
the erasing mechanism 400 comprises a pushing table 17, a roller 18, a connecting column 19, a moving frame 20 and a vibration erasing component for erasing chalk marks on the writing surface of the writing display panel 2, wherein the pushing table 17 is arranged on the lifting frame 15, the pushing table 17 is provided with an arc-shaped guide surface for preventing the vibration erasing component from interfering the rotation of the writing display panel 2 when the writing display panel 2 rotates and enabling the vibration erasing component to be in contact with the writing display panel 2 after the writing display panel 2 rotates, two ends of the connecting column 19 are respectively connected with the roller 18 and the moving frame 20, the vibration erasing component is arranged on the moving frame 20, and an elastic tensioning component for enabling the roller 18 to be abutted against the arc-shaped guide surface and enabling the moving frame 20 to move longitudinally is arranged in the mounting cover 1;
the control platform 100 is respectively connected with the projector 200, the driving component and the vibration erasing component in a control mode.
The embodiment of the invention can write on the writing display board 2, can remove chalk marks after the writing display board 2 is turned over, saves time and labor, and can project a wider range of pictures on the writing display board 2 through the projector 200. The mounting cover 1 is mounted on a platform, and the projector 200 is mounted on a ceiling of a classroom facing the writing display panel 2. The writing display board 2 is provided with a writing surface and a display surface, the writing display board 2 is in a vertical state in an initial state, and a user can write teaching contents on the writing surface arranged forwards by using chalk; the plurality of writing display panels 2 can also be used for indicating the user along the horizontal writing content, so that the user can regularly write the teaching content and the impression is better. When the writing display board 2 needs to be turned over for 180 degrees, the driving assembly is controlled through the control platform 100, the lifting frame 15 is controlled to ascend by utilizing the driving assembly, the lifting frame 15 drives the rack 16 to ascend, the rack 16 drives the gear 9 to rotate, the gear 9 drives the writing display board 2 to rotate for 180 degrees through the rotating shaft 8, so that the writing surface rotates to the inward direction, the display surface rotates to the outward direction, in the rotating process of the writing display board 2, the lifting frame 15 drives the pushing platform 17 to ascend, the elastic tensioning assembly can ensure that the roller 18 is always abutted against the arc-shaped guide surface, the connecting column 19 and the moving frame 20 move along with the roller 18 along the longitudinal direction, the pushing platform 17 firstly pushes the roller 18 to move along the longitudinal direction away from the writing display board 2 through the arc-shaped guide surface, when the roller 18 rolls to the farthest end, the writing display board 2 rotates to, the roller 18 continues to roll on the curved guide surface and moves in the opposite direction in the longitudinal direction, and when the writing display panel 2 is rotated by 180, the roller 18 rolls to the bottom end of the curved guide surface and the vibration erasing member comes into contact with the writing surface of the writing display panel 2. When the vibration erasing component is applied to clearing chalk marks, the vibration erasing component is controlled by the control platform 100 to erase the chalk marks on the writing surface; when the writing display board is applied to projection, the control platform 100 controls the projector 200, the projector 200 projects pictures on the display surface, the picture display effect is clear, the display surfaces of the plurality of writing display boards 2 are fully utilized for display, and the display area is larger. The smooth rotation of the writing display board 2 is realized by using one driving component, the vibration erasing component is ensured not to be contacted with the writing display board 2 in the rotation process, and is contacted with the writing display board 2 after the rotation is finished, so that the subsequent chalk erasing treatment is facilitated, the structure is ingenious and compact, and the use cost is low.
In an alternative embodiment, the writing display panel 2 is provided with two mounting grooves 201 at both ends in the width direction, the writing display assembly further comprises an elastic leveling assembly, two sets of the elastic leveling assembly are provided, and the two sets of the elastic leveling assembly are respectively located at the two mounting grooves 201, the elastic leveling assembly comprises a sliding frame 3, a first elastic member 5, a second elastic member 6 and an elastic sleeve 7, the sliding frame 3 is slidably arranged on the writing display panel 2 along the thickness direction of the writing display panel 2, the sliding frame 3 comprises a sliding portion located inside the mounting groove 201 and a connecting portion located outside the mounting groove 201, the sliding portion and the connecting portion are integrally formed, the first elastic member 5 and the second elastic member 6 are both arranged along the thickness direction of the writing display panel 2, the first elastic member 5 and the second elastic member 6 are respectively located at both sides of the sliding frame 3, both ends of the first elastic member 5 are respectively connected with the inner wall at one side of the mounting groove, two ends of the second elastic member 6 are respectively connected with the other side surface of the sliding frame 3 and the inner wall of the other side of the mounting groove 201, the elastic sleeve 7 is sleeved on the connecting part of the sliding frame 3, and the maximum size of the elastic sleeve 7 along the thickness direction of the writing display board 2 is equal to one half of the thickness size of the writing display board 2.
It should be noted that, when the writing display panel 2 is in the vertical state, the elastic sleeve 7 at the top of the lower writing display panel 2 can contact with the elastic sleeve 7 at the bottom of the adjacent upper writing display panel 2, so as to fill the gap between the adjacent two writing display panels 2 in the vertical direction, thereby improving the structural regularity and being more beneficial to clearly and completely displaying the picture projected by the projector 200. In the process of rotating the writing display board 2, the writing display board 2 can drive the elastic leveling component to rotate, and the elastic sleeve 7 can elastically deform in the rotating process, so that the smooth rotating process of the writing display board 2 cannot be blocked. After writing display panel 2 and rotating 180, write two sets of elasticity on the display panel 2 and fill the high interchange of subassembly, the elastic sleeve 7 that originally is in the top outside is in the bottom outside after rotating, the elastic sleeve 7 that originally is in the bottom inboard is in the top inboard after rotating, 2 thickness direction slip of display panel are write along to carriage 3, first elastic component 5 and second elastic component 6 can ensure two carriages 3 and two elastic sleeves 7 that correspond and be in the pressure state, make the different writing face and the display surface that write display panel 2 can be more regular be in on two planes, the clean and tidy nature of structure has been guaranteed.
In an alternative embodiment, the elastic tensioning assemblies are arranged in a plurality of groups side by side along the transverse direction, each elastic tensioning assembly comprises a slide rail 25, a fourth elastic member 28 and a connecting assembly, the connecting assembly is symmetrically arranged in two groups along the vertical direction, each connecting assembly comprises a first connecting platform 21, a connecting rod 22, a second connecting platform 23, a slide block 24, a third elastic member 27 and a guide rod 29, the slide rails 25 are vertically arranged on the inner surface of the mounting cover 1, the first connecting platforms 21 are arranged on the moving frame 20, two ends of the connecting rods 22 are respectively rotatably connected with the first connecting platforms 21 and the second connecting platforms 23, the second connecting platforms 23 are arranged on the slide blocks 24, the slide blocks 24 are arranged on the slide rails 25 in a sliding manner along the vertical direction, the third elastic members 27 are vertically connected between the slide blocks 24 and the inner surface of the mounting cover 1, the fourth elastic members 28 are connected between the two slide blocks 24 in the two groups of connecting assemblies, the guide, the moving frame 20 is slidably disposed on the guide bar 29 in the longitudinal direction.
It should be noted that, when the pushing and pressing table 17 pushes the roller 18 to move, the roller 18 drives the first connecting table 21 to move longitudinally through the connecting column 19 and the moving frame 20, the guide rod 29 is used for guiding the moving direction of the moving frame 20, the first connecting table 21 drives the second connecting table 23 to move downwards through the connecting rod 22, the second connecting table 23 drives the slider 24 to move downwards, the slide rail 25 guides the moving process of the slider 24, the third elastic member 27 is stretched, the fourth elastic member 28 is compressed, elastic potential energy is stored in the third elastic member 27 and the fourth elastic member 28, the roller 18 can be maintained at a position in rolling contact with the arc-shaped guide surface, the third elastic member 27 and the fourth elastic member 28 are both vertically arranged and can be stretched in the vertical direction, so that the occupied space of the whole elastic tensioning assembly is smaller.
In an alternative embodiment, the writing display panel 2 is provided with a fixing rod 4 along the thickness direction, the fixing rod 4 is positioned inside the mounting groove 201, the fixing rod 4 penetrates through the sliding frame 3 and is slidably connected with the sliding frame 3, the inner surface of the mounting cover 1 is vertically provided with a limiting rod 26, and the limiting rod 26 penetrates through the sliding block 24 and is slidably connected with the sliding block 24; the first elastic piece 5, the second elastic piece 6, the third elastic piece 27 and the fourth elastic piece 28 are compression springs, the first elastic piece 5 and the second elastic piece 6 are sleeved on the periphery of the fixed rod 4, and the third elastic piece 27 and the fourth elastic piece 28 are sleeved on the periphery of the limiting rod 26.
The carriage 3 can slide on the fixed rod 4, the slider 24 can slide on the stopper rod 26, the first elastic member 5 and the second elastic member 6 can expand and contract on the outer peripheral side of the fixed rod 4, the third elastic member 27 and the fourth elastic member 28 can expand and contract on the outer peripheral side of the stopper rod 26, and the first elastic member 5, the second elastic member 6, the third elastic member 27 and the fourth elastic member 28 can be stably used without falling off and have a long service life.
In an optional embodiment, the driving assembly comprises a motor 10, a screw rod 11, a screw rod nut 111, a bracket 12, a sliding table 13 and a guide rail 14, the motor 10, the bracket 12 and the guide rail 14 are all arranged on the inner surface of the mounting cover 1, the screw rod 11 and the guide rail 14 are both vertically arranged, the motor 10 is in driving connection with the screw rod 11, the screw rod 11 is in threaded connection with the screw rod nut 111, the screw rod 11 is in rotating connection with the bracket 12, the screw rod nut 111 is connected with the sliding table 13, the sliding table 13 is arranged on the guide rail 14 in a sliding manner along the vertical direction, and the sliding table 13; the control platform 100 is in control connection with the motor 10.
It should be noted that, motor 10's output can just reverse, motor 10 output drive lead screw 11 rotates, lead screw 11 drives screw-nut 111 and removes, screw-nut 111 drives slip table 13 and removes, guide rail 14 is used for leading slip table 13, make slip table 13 can be stable remove along vertical direction, thereby can utilize slip table 13 to drive the stable lift of crane 15, lead screw 11 and screw-nut 111 threaded connection, because threaded connection's auto-lock nature, after having adjusted and having written display panel 2, write display panel 2 can be stable maintain the vertical state after adjusting, the user can be on writing the face steady write teaching content.
In an alternative embodiment, the vibration erasing assembly comprises an elastic vibration assembly, a connecting plate 33, a mounting plate 35 and a brush 36, the elastic vibration assembly is provided with a plurality of groups, the elastic vibration assembly comprises an elastic column 31, a connecting frame 32 and an eccentric shaft vibration exciter 34 which is arranged on the connecting plate 33 and is used for driving the mounting plate 35 to vibrate in a vertical plane, the brush 36 is vertically arranged on the front side surface of the mounting plate 35, the brushes 36 are arranged in a plurality of groups side by side along the transverse direction, a chip falling channel is arranged between adjacent brushes 36, two ends of the elastic column 31 are respectively connected with the moving frame 20 and the connecting frame 32, the connecting frame 32 is arranged on the mounting plate 35, the connecting plate 33 is connected with the moving frame 20, the vibration amplitude size of the mounting plate 35 in the transverse direction is larger than that of the chip falling channel along the transverse direction, the erasing; the control platform 100 is in control connection with the eccentric shaft exciter 34.
It should be noted that, when the pushing platform 17 pushes the roller 18 to move away from the direction of the writing display board 2, the brush 36 moves away from the direction of the writing display board 2, and during the rotation of the writing display board 2, the brush 36 will not contact with the writing display board 2, so as to avoid interference to the rotation of the writing display board 2, and after the rotation of the writing display board 2 is completed, the brush 36 contacts with the writing display board 2 again. When the chalk marks on the writing surface of the writing display panel 2 need to be cleaned, the eccentric shaft vibration exciter 34 can drive the mounting plate 35 to vibrate in a vertical plane, the elastic column 31 can elastically deform in the vibration process, the brush 36 is maintained in a state of contacting with the writing surface, the brush 36 is used for erasing the chalk marks, and the erased chips fall through a falling chip channel.
In an optional embodiment, the chip removing mechanism 500 further comprises a connecting cover 37, a chip inlet pipe 38, a connecting pipe 39, a negative pressure fan 40, a filter screen 41, a conveying pipe 42, a chip collecting box 43, a counter-flow preventing table 44 and a fixing frame 45, wherein the connecting cover 37 is arranged at the bottom of the mounting cover 1, the chip inlet pipe 38 is vertically arranged, the chip inlet pipe 38 penetrates through the top of the connecting cover 37 and the bottom of the mounting cover 1, the chip inlet pipe 38 is transversely arranged side by side, the top end of the chip inlet pipe 38 faces a chip falling channel, the bottom end of the chip inlet pipe 38 is communicated with the connecting pipe 39, the connecting pipe 39 and the negative pressure fan 40 are both arranged on the connecting cover 37, the end of the connecting pipe 39 is communicated with the air suction end of the negative pressure fan 40, a chip falling port 391 is arranged at the lower part of the connecting pipe 39, the filter screen 41 is arranged on the inner surface of the connecting pipe 39, the bottom end of the filter screen 41 is arranged, one end of the conveying pipe 42 is communicated with the connecting pipe 39 through a chip falling port 391, the other end of the conveying pipe 42 is communicated with the top of the chip collecting box 43, the top of the chip collecting box 43 is lower than the bottom of the connecting pipe 39, the chip collecting box 43 is arranged on the inner surface of the connecting cover 37, a first cleaning port is arranged on the chip collecting box 43, the anti-backflow platform 44 is of a conical structure, the conical top is arranged upwards, a circulation channel is formed between the bottom edge of the anti-backflow platform 44 and the inner wall of the chip collecting box 43, the anti-backflow platform 44 is arranged on the fixing frame 45, the fixing frame 45 is arranged on the inner surface of the chip collecting box 43, a second cleaning port correspondingly communicated with the first cleaning port is arranged on the connecting cover 37, and a box door 46 for plugging the first cleaning port and the second cleaning port is detachably arranged on; the control platform 100 is in control connection with the negative pressure fan 40.
It should be noted that when the chalk marks on the writing surface are erased through the vibration erasing component, the operation of the negative pressure fan 40 is simultaneously controlled, the negative pressure fan 40 draws air from the chip inlet pipe 38 through the connecting pipe 39, so that the chalk chips falling from the chip falling channel are sucked into the connecting pipe 39, the chalk chips are intercepted by the filter screen 41, because the filter screen 41 is obliquely arranged, the chalk chips can fall into the chip collecting box 43 through the conveying pipe 42, slide down from the top along the backflow preventing table 44 and fall to the lower part of the inner side of the chip collecting box 43 through the flowing channel, backflow is not easy to occur, and the collecting effect is good; when the chalk debris needs to be cleaned, the box door 46 is opened, and the chalk debris in the debris collection box 43 is cleaned out, so that the chalk debris cleaning box is very convenient to use.
In an alternative embodiment, the two limiting plates 30 are vertically arranged at two ends of the lifting frame 15 in the vertical direction, the two limiting plates 30 are respectively arranged at two ends of the arc-shaped guide surface, the pushing and pressing table 17 is provided with a limiting groove 171, the groove bottom of the limiting groove 171 is an arc-shaped surface which is arranged in a manner of offsetting from the arc-shaped guide surface, and the end of the guide rod 29 is connected with a limiting table.
It should be noted that the limiting plate 30 can limit the rolling range of the roller 18, so that the roller 18 can roll on the pressing table 17 more smoothly; by arranging the limiting groove 181, the rolling range of the roller 18 can be guided and limited in the transverse direction, so that the roller 18 can roll more stably and accurately; by providing the stopper, the movable frame 20 can be prevented from falling off the guide bar 29.
In an alternative embodiment, the method of use comprises the steps of:
s1, in an initial state, the writing display board 2 is vertically arranged, the writing surface faces to the outer side, the display surface faces to the inner side, a user can write on the writing surface with chalk, the writing surface can be a black or green writing surface, the display surface is located on the inner side of the mounting cover 1 and can be protected, the display surface can be a white, gray or green writing surface, the white effect is best, and when white chalk fragments remained on the vibration erasing component are stuck to the white display surface, the display effect of the white display surface cannot be influenced;
s2, through control platform 100 control drive assembly, drive assembly drive crane 15 goes up and down, crane 15 drives rack 16 and goes up and down, rack 16 drives gear 9 and rotates, gear 9 drives through axis of rotation 8 and writes display panel 2 and rotate, will write display panel 2 upset 180, the orientation of face and display surface is write in the pair change, make and write the face towards the inboard, the display surface is towards the outside, include following A1 and A2 two kinds of application situations altogether:
a1, controlling the projector 200 to project pictures on the display surface through the control platform 100, wherein the display area is larger, after the use, the writing display panel 2 is rotated to the initial state, and the display surface is positioned at the inner side of the mounting cover 1 again, so that the effective protection can be achieved;
a2, control the vibration through control platform 100 and erase the chalk vestige that the subassembly erased on the writing surface, then switch over the writing surface to the position towards the outside, be used for writing again, avoid artifical manual cleanness, labour saving and time saving saves the teaching time.
